about guide dogs:
They must be allowed. However, the owner is responsible for the dog's behavior
My opinion: . If it disrupts museum visitors, there is no harm in
approaching the owner and asking what they can do to calm the dog.  If they
have no suggestions, then I would offer them to see a different part of a
museum, or even to sit and relax until matters can be handled.
The key is to do it politely, calmly and with a smile.
